12

本質的な問題を伴う別の質問。私のWSDLファイルの最後に。

<wsdl:service name="Lighting">
    <wsdl:port name="SwitchPower" binding="tns:SwitchPower">
        <soap:address location="http://localhost:8080/Lighting/SwitchPower/" />
    </wsdl:port>
    <wsdl:port name="Dimming" binding="tns:Dimming">
        <soap:address location="http://localhost:8080/Lighting/Dimming/" />
    </wsdl:port>
</wsdl:service>

2 つのポートで同じサービス。そうですか?

いいえの場合、仕様の規則は何ですか?

4

2 に答える 2

1
  • 各ポートは一意のバインディングを参照します (複数のバインディングを持つことができます)
  • 各バインディングは単一の portType を参照できます
  • 複数のバインディングは、同じ portType または異なる portType を参照できます (複数の portType を持つことができます)
  • したがって、複数の portType がある場合は、バインディングを参照して複数のポートを公開します。
    ここに画像の説明を入力

画像提供

于 2017-11-08T01:25:55.913 に答える